Participants will learn about the rights and responsibilities of employees and supervisors as they pertain to forklift truck operators.
This part-time course consists of four hours of theory and four hours of practical driving experience. Individuals will study topics including types of trucks and material handling techniques.
Upon successful completion, participants will receive a Durham College certificate and wallet-size card.
Prerequisites:
- Previous driving experience or G2 driver’s licence suggested; and
- Required safety equipment: safety boots, glasses and work gloves.
